King’s Quest Returns: New Title Debuts at The Game Awards

The newest addition to the adventure series will debut this Friday.

Geoff Keighley has announced that the newest King’s Quest will be revealed at The Game Awards this Friday, December 5th. It will be one of the dozen world premieres to appear at the show and will showcase what developer The Odd Gentlemen has been up to with the game.

Along with a look at the new game, there will also be a tribute to Roberta and Ken Williams who founded Sierra and helped push forward the adventure genre. King’s Quest was one of the major franchises under their banner.

King’s Quest had a long and illustrious history in the old days but the latest game in the series was delayed for several years, passes off from one studio to another before Activision picked up the rights.

The new King’s Quest will be an adventure game but will move away from the point-and-click mechanics of the old games. We’ll keep our eyes open for when it debuts to stay tuned for more information.
